AN ACT to amend the elder law, in relation to creating the office of
older adult workforce development within the office for the aging
The People of the State of New York, represented in Senate and Assem-bly, do enact as follows:
1 Section 1. The elder law is amended by adding a new section 225 to
2 read as follows:
3 § 225. Office of older adult workforce development. 1. The office
4 shall establish an office of older adult workforce development. Such
5 office of older adult workforce development shall be headed by a coordi-
6 nator who shall be appointed by the director. The coordinator shall
7 work in consultation with the department of labor in the course of their
8 duties.
9 2. The coordinator of the office of older adult workforce development
10 shall have the following duties:
11 (a) advise and assist the state in planning and implementing for coor-
12 dination and cooperation among agencies involved in workforce develop-
13 ment to address the needs of older adults regarding the workplace;
14 (b) create a centralized website with resources for job placement,
15 career building and development, and job support for older adults;
16 (c) provide information on how to report age discrimination in the
17 workplace, including potential state remedies for such discrimination;
18 (d) review information upon request of state agencies regarding
19 complaints concerning age discrimination in the workplace and develop
20 recommendations, guidelines, and protocols to address recurring problems
21 or trends, in consultation with industry representatives, advocates, and
22 state agencies;
23 (e) provide outreach and education on the services provided by the
24 office of older adult workforce development; and
25 (f) perform other duties as the director may assign to the coordina-
26 tor.
27 § 2. This act shall take effect immediately.
